More about ict security specialist courses in Goulburn

If you are looking to launch your career as an ICT Security Specialist, exploring the available ICT Security Specialist courses in Goulburn is a fantastic step towards achieving your professional goals. This vibrant regional city in New South Wales is home to accredited training organisations that provide comprehensive courses designed to equip you with the necessary skills and knowledge in today's rapidly evolving cybersecurity landscape. By enrolling in these programs, you will gain insights into critical areas such as risk assessment, threat management, and security compliance, laying a solid foundation for your future.

In addition to pursuing ICT Security Specialist courses in Goulburn, students may find interest in various related job roles that can complement their training. Positions such as Chief Information Security Officer (CISO), Cyber Security Consultant, and Cyber Security Analyst are just a few examples of rewarding career paths in this dynamic field. Each role presents its unique challenges and opportunities, enabling professionals to specialise in different aspects of cybersecurity while contributing to the protection of critical information assets.

By receiving training in ICT Security Specialist courses in Goulburn, you will not only enhance your technical proficiencies but also improve your employability in a competitive job market. With the increasing demand for skilled cybersecurity professionals, pursuing expertise in areas such as Penetration Testing or becoming a Cyber Defender offers numerous prospects for personal and career development.
